6 lbs. of meth, $60k seized from trailer 

Police seized more than six pounds of methamphetamine and $60,000 from a trailer near the Fairchild Airforce Base on Thursday. Gerardo S. Miramontes, 35, and Rigoberto Ayala, 32, face drug and gun charges after a search warrant was served at 15610 W. Highway 2. A…

Gang probe includes 2 murder suspects 

Two of 24 suspects named Thursday in a long-term gun and drug investigation by the Spokane Violent Crimes Gang Task Force already are in jail on murder charges. Edward L. "TD" Thomas, 26, (left) already faces life in prison under Washington's three-strikes law if convicted…
